LightMP3 v2.0.0 BETA2 released - Image 1Sakya has released an update for his popular LightMP3 application, turning it into LightMP3 v2.0.0 BETA 2. For those who haven't heard of it, LightMP3 is a lightweight, power-saving music player application that supports MP3, OGG Vorbis, ATRAC3 , and FLAC. PSP Homebrew: LightMP3 v2.0.0 Alpha 4 - Image 1Sakya has released a new version of LightMP3 on the PSP Development forum. This latest release ups the playlist limit to 300 tracks, allows the use of .PNG files as coverart, and adds a Shuffle/Repeat play mode. A complete changelog is in the full article.
